Marilyn Manson had an awkward encounter with teen pop idol, Justin Bieber. It all started with the when Bieber copied the design of one of Manson's iconic t-shirt design. The shirt was sold at Barney's $195 while you can buy the t-shirt for much more cheaper at other stores for less then half of the price Bieber was asking for. While wearing the the t-shirt Bieber claimed that he "made Manson relevant again."
In an interview with Consequence of Sound. "I took all the proceeds the proceeds from those shirts from him. They didn't even fight, 'Yeah, we know we did wrong, so here's the money. He said to me, 'I made you relevant again.' Bad mistake to say to me. The next day I told him I'd be at his soundcheck at Staples Center to do 'Beautiful People.' He believed that I'd show up, because he was that stupid." After his encounter with Bieber this what Manson said, "He was a real piece of shit in the way he had the arrogance to say that. He was a real touchy feely guy, too, like, 'Yo yo bro!' and touches you when he's talking. I'm like, you need to stand down, you're dick height on me, ok? (Laughs) Alright?
